Understand Your Youngster's Civil liberties
Recognizing your youngster's civil liberties is critical for guaranteeing they receive the support they require. When your kid has dyslexia, understanding their legal rights can encourage you to promote successfully. The People with Impairments Education Act (IDEA) warranties your child access to a free and ideal public education. This implies schools must provide certain services tailored to their one-of-a-kind requirements.

If your child is deemed eligible, they ought to receive an Individualized Education and learning Program (IEP) developed to sustain their knowing. The IEP outlines specific accommodations, like additional time on examinations or access to assistive technology, which can substantially boost their academic experience.
Furthermore, Section 504 of the Rehab Act shields your child from discrimination based on their dyslexia. This regulations ensures they have actually equal access to educational chances and can participate totally in institution activities.
Remain educated regarding their rights, and don't hesitate to speak up if you feel these legal rights aren't being fulfilled. Bear in mind, you're your child's ideal supporter, and recognizing their civil liberties is the very first step towards ensuring they get the assistance they should have.
Communicate Properly With Educators
Efficient interaction with educators is vital for supporting for your youngster with dyslexia. Begin by developing a favorable partnership with your child's educators, administrators, and assistance team. Approach them with an open mind and a joint spirit, as this establishes the tone for effective discussions.
Be clear and succinct when reviewing your kid's requirements. Prepare details instances of how dyslexia affects their knowing and provide any kind of relevant documents, such as analyses or reports. This helps instructors comprehend your child's special obstacles and toughness.
Ask concerns to clarify their viewpoints and approaches. Understanding the school's strategy allows you to straighten your campaigning for initiatives effectively. On a regular basis check in with instructors to monitor your youngster's progression and maintain a recurring dialogue.
Do not think twice to express your worries, but do so pleasantly. Usage "I" statements to share your experiences, like "I've discovered my kid struggles with checking out in your home." This promotes a collective atmosphere where every person really feels valued.
Finally, be patient and persistent; developing a strong interaction foundation requires time yet is critical for your child's success in college.
